The 42157 ZIP Code is associated with the city of Mount Hermon in Kentucky in Monroe County in the United States. The current population estimate is 720. The median age in the 42157 ZIP Code is 23.8 years, with 7.9% of residents aged 62 years and older.

Age Breakdown in ZIP Code 42157

Residents of ZIP Code 42157 are younger than average. The median age of 23.8 years in ZIP Code 42157 is approximately 37.53% lower than the overall median age in the U.S. of 38.1 years. About 63.5% of residents are aged 18 years and older, and 7.9% of residents are 62 years and over. Approximately 15.7% of the population in 42157 falls in the age group 25 to 34 years, while an estimated 12.5% are aged under 5 years. On the low end of the scale, 0.0% of 42157 residents are aged 85 years and over.

Jobs Breakdown in ZIP Code 42157

In 42157, 66.2% of the population is in the labor force. Recent estimates place 38.7% as working from home, while the total labor force in the region has a mean travel to time to work of 16.8 minutes. Approximately 61.3% of the employed population 16 years and over in 42157 work in agriculture, forestry, fishing and hunting, and mining, while an estimated 8.9% work in construction. On the lower end of the scale, just 0.0% of 42157 workers 16 years and over work in public administration.
